The waterjet steel cutting process works by first propelling water through a small nozzle at extremely high speeds . The water is forced through a 0.010″ to 0.015″ in diameter hole in a jewel.

EAN-Code 8710364042852. 2615S456JD.The process creates a thunderstorm in the sheet metal: In nature, a thunderstorm produces ozone (O3) as plasma gas when an arc discharges electrically. This can be smelled as "clean air" after a thunderstorm. Plasma is an electrically conductive gas. When cutting a bolt to length, first thread a nut onto the length you plan to keep. Oxy-fuel cutting is a chemical reaction that is widely used for cutting steel because it is cost efficient, and can cut through steel with thicknesses ranging from 0.5mm to 250mm. Do not apply too much …The principle of water jet cutting operation consists of accelerating the mix of water and abrasive medium to the sound velocity. At such speed, the water penetrates into the metal that is being cut and just like the previous cutting techniques, cuts the metal.
